A Comparative Study of the Biological Activity of Skin and Granular Gland Secretions of Leptodactylus latrans and Hypsiboas pulchellus from Argentina

Abstract: the potential of the skin of anuran amphibians as a new source of bioactive peptides was investigated .For this purpose, the study collected data in the mid-eastern region of Argentina. Two anuran amphibian specieswere studied which belong to the Hylidae and Leptodactylidae families, Leptodatylus latrans (Ll) and Hypsiboaspulchellus (Hp). Two methods for the extraction of bioactive components were compared in their effectiveness:solvent extraction (SE) and transcutaneous amphibian stimulation (TAS). Two different approaches were used tostudy the extracts: i) the direct analysis of the complete samples by MALDI-TOF-MS, and ii) thecharacterization of bioactive fractions obtained by HPLC and analyzed by MS. The results show that not onlythe composition of the samples obtained by SE and TAS is different but also their antimicrobial activity. In thissense, only the extracts obtained from Ll and Hp by SE inhibited the growth of Mycobacterium tuberculosisH37Rv. The inhibitory activity of the extracts against the butyrylcholinesterase enzyme (BChE) was alsoinvestigated. Samples of Ll showed low percentages of inhibition whereas in Hp samples, the inhibition wasmoderate (40 -44%). The results suggest that the inhibitory activity of Hp is related to the presence of lowmolecular weight compounds.
